Mallika S. Sarma is an Assistant Professor in the Department of Anthropology at the University of Pennsylvania, directing the Health and BioBehavior Lab (HaBBLab). As a human biologist, she investigates biobehavioral adaptations to stress and extreme environments.
- Education: PhD & MA in Anthropology from University of Notre Dame; BS in Evolutionary Anthropology & Psychology from University of Michigan
Her research spans neuroendocrine systems, energetic physiology, and social support mechanisms in environments like the Himalayas, Congo Basin, Rocky Mountains, and spaceflight. Recent work emphasizes stress resilience in unpredictable contexts, integrating biological anthropology with evolutionary theory.
